Try enabling Cursor Smooth Caret Animation in VSCode settings along with this font and it will feel like you are writing on a paper with a pen! I enjoy using ligature fonts for coding so that symbols like arrows look like arrows and does-not-equal signs look like the real thing from math class ().The problem is that, even with the contextual smarts built into ligature fonts like Fira Code, ligatures have a knack of popping up where you don’t want them. FiraCode is available on GitHub, and is a based on the concept of ligatures, targeting at programming symbols.. To learn more about setting up Powerline in your command prompt, visit the Powerline in Windows Terminal page. Fira Code in Atom Editor (Monospaced font with programming ligatures) It seems a lot of developers transitioned from Atom to Visual Studio Code.However, Atom still shines by its simplicity. Based on the post ‘Monospaced Programming Fonts with Ligatures‘ from Scott Hanselman I tried if that works in for the classic Visual Studio too. Fonts Operator Mono Lig. 09 Aug 2020 | vscode fonts themes. 👉 GitHub: tonsky/FiraCode. Just select Fira Code and restart Visual Studio. Here are 6 of the best fonts that support ligatures (according to www.slant.co) Coding with Ligatures. If you feel for trying it out in VSCode you should open settings (cmd-,/ctrl-,) and enable “Font Ligatures”. Different fonts may support a different set of ligatures. Fantasque Sans Mono is my choice for the past two years. If you still need help, here is a video walking through the process of configuring ligatures in VS Code. Pro. #1. Fira Code is an extension of Fira Mono, a monospaced font designed for Mozilla to fit in with the character of Firefox OS. Powerline is a common command-line plugin that allows you to display additional information in your prompt. Nerd Fonts has a collection of fonts that have been patched with ligatures they also provide a script which can patch any font. Cascadia Code supports programming ligatures! Pragmata is a monospaced font with ligatures built with programming, math, and engineering in mind. WRITTEN BY. Ad. 3 minutes to read. Looks really beautiful. - microsoft/cascadia-code In programming, that basically means you’ll see ⇒ instead of => and ≥ instead of >= and so on. Different fonts will support a different number of ligatures, so try a few to decide what works for you. Writing style makes reading easy and convenient. Monospaced font with programming ligatures. Fira Code. .mtk13, .mtk16 { … Gotchas To balance whitespace more efficiently by shifting the glyphs in certain cases. Fira Code. What are the best monospace programming fonts with ligatures? What are the best free fonts you recommend to use while writing code in VScode? If VS Code is your main editor, having a clean UI can bring a productivity boost. 2. Ligatures is a font feature, that allows you to display multiple consecutive characters as one custom glyph! For example, instead of: === you’ll get: It can help make your code more legible (and thus easier to spot bugs). Hope this doesn't break Rule 2 - it's about Codespaces which is Microsoft's official browser-based hosted VSCode environment so it's still relevant. This is Operator Mono font with programming ligatures. Ligatures in programming fonts usually don't want to solve the problem of character collisions. Ligatures Limited Code ligatures only where you want them, not where you don’t. Roboto Mono is crystal clear which makes it a good choice for reading code without your eyes getting tired. This page is powered by a knowledgeable community that helps you make an informed decision. Looks like a custom font I guess. Changing the typography can help give cleaner text and allow you to focus on the content at large rather than the text alone. The editor used in the making of the screenshot is the open source editor from Microsoft, Visual Studio Code. I followed the instructions in this blog post Multiple Fonts: Alternative to Operator Mono in VSCode, but did not see any changes made to VS Code.After digging a bit, I discovered that all the CSS class names had changed. Pros. It uses a few additional glyphs to display this information properly. Eyestrain is a real issue for software developers, and the font they choose to work with plays a big role in that. Fell in love with the looks of this font. Take a look at this example from FiraCode’s GitHub repo: Some people love ligatures. Fonts With Ligatures. I welcome you to the world of open source code fonts with well-made ligatures and finely tuned spacing. "Many ligatures supported" is the primary reason people pick Fira Code over the competition. Let's get right into it. It can make the horror of a messy codebase feels slightly less horrific. Last up on our list of paid fonts, and my personal favorite, is PragmataPro. Screenshots are all made with VSCode from the same code snippet. Fira Code is one of the most popular fonts for developers, having been developed with special programming ligatures from Mozilla's Fira Mono typeface. Instead they transform rather weird symbol sequences used in programing to something closer to symbols used in maths or how you would write it by hand, e.g. Here, we'll look at ten fonts favoured by programmers, including some of the latest typefaces and some retro classics. All the instructions to install the font and configuring it in the IDE’s including Visual Studio and Visual Studio Code is documented in the wiki. Ligatures are a font that will merge several characters into a single one, to make them more legible or to stand out in some way. I've been using Fira Code as my new dev font. You can make your editor look better with awesome fonts along with ligatures. This is a fun, new monospaced font that includes programming ligatures and is designed to enhance the modern look and feel of the Windows Terminal. Clean and legible. Now, open Visual Studio's Options menu and under "Fonts and Colors", you'll find the Fira Code to select as Visual Studio font. Ligatures on Ligatures off. Theme Screenshot. Previously Used Fantasque Sans Mono. Font Ligatures in Visual Studio are enabled by default. Benefits of ligatures Anonymous Pro. They’re now e.g. Google searches on using ligatures and cursive fonts will yield multiple results - such as this article by Mohammed Zama Khan. != becomes ≠, =< becomes ≤, or === becomes ≡. From the menu Tools -> Options -> Fonts and Colors, select the font from the properly dropdown. idbartosz/vscode-darkpp-italic: Enhanced VScode , Enhanced VScode Dark+ theme with support for Fira Code iScript and Fira Code + Operator Mono fonts. Spending some time to personalise the look and feel of your editor can give your digital life a more homely feeling. Powerline and programming ligatures. Ligatures on Ligatures off. In Emacs you would typically use really obscure functions like set-fontset-font , font-spec , etc. 3. A great paid option is Operator Mono which's $200 and a free option is Fira Code. Tried running that font from at WhatTheFont but couldn't find it. Programming ligatures are most useful when writing code, as they create new glyphs by combining characters. This helps make code more readable and user-friendly for some people. I ranked the fonts with the following metrics: Whether similar characters are distinguishable, such as 0O, 1lI; Whether the font style (line width, character width / height) is easy to read; And my personal preference! And most importantly, all these fonts are FREE! Programming ligatures help to read and understand code faster: Fira Code supports modern web browsers and many popular editors such as Visual Studio Code, IntelliJ, Atom, PhpStorm and Xcode. Customizing VS Code. Fonts that support ligatures come with detailed metadata describing – to all who may care – how to ligate text; use swash or small caps; old-style numerals, you name it. The code variant of Fira includes programming ligatures – these are special renderings of certain character combinations that are designed to make code easier to read and understand. ... Unpack fonts to ~/.local/share/fonts (or /usr/share/fonts, to install fonts system-wide) and fc-cache -f -v. It was during the summer of ’18 that I established the syntax-highlighted colorful code blocks on this site with Prism.I truly loved creating this (even while on vacation) and wanted to put the icing on the cake by using a special developer font called Fira Code.Its specialty lies in combining multi-character programming symbols into one.It’s all about how characters connect. Now, we're ready to use ligature in our code in Visual Studio. What are the best password fonts? And I'm sticking with it. Conclusion I used to setup all my IDE and editors with Fira Code, but now I switched everything to Cascadia Code. I work primarily in frontend development, so VSCode is my primary editor. The main project I'm working on (a big React app) has started to get too big for my personal computer to easily handle. Dank Mono patched with Nerd Fonts + Operator Mono set with Custom CSS and JS Loader is used in the example below. Below, I've attached a quick snap of my code, find the differences! | | | :--: | Theme installation. Roboto Mono. Posted September 21, 2020 By AHA. It can give you a glow of satisfaction when you open some code you are proud of. i use it everywhere. Here is some sample TypeScript code written in Visual Studio 2017: Press question mark to learn the rest of the keyboard shortcuts ... even where ligatures are not supported, this is one of the best looking fonts. Mohammed’s solution, however, was to use two fonts - Fira Code and Fira Flott and then reference a custom CSS file within his VSCode settings.json. Customizing Typography in VS Code January 06, 2019 - . Screenshot of dummy Fira Code is a free monospaced font containing ligatures for common programming multi-character combinations. If they choose a font that’s not designed well enough, the punctuation or characters may be hard to distinguish, which makes them have to concentrate and focus more to make them out, which leads to headaches, eyestrain, and a generally lower productivity rate than ideal. JetBrains Mono font family. Press J to jump to the feed. Fira Code, Hasklig, and Iosevka are probably your best bets out of the 11 options considered. It is a must-try font, if you haven’t used Operator Mono before. to define how Emacs displays character ranges and which font to use. Once you’ve made these changes you should be ready to start taking advantage of ligatures in your code. With standard fonts your eye spends a non-zero amount of energy to scan, parse and join multiple characters into a single logical one. Roboto Mono has a very clean and beautiful design. extralight. A font designed for Mozilla with coding ligatures (Image credit: Mozilla). FiraCode Anonymous Pro is designed as a coding font with a few specific improvements over others in mind: Characters that could be mistaken for each other like 0 (zero) vs O (capital O) are intentionally differentiated, and the font is built to work well down to very small sizes.. To use this font, see Anonymous Pro on Google Fonts Font ligatures is a typography term to describe when two or more characters (or graphemes) are joined as a single glyph. Comparison. Just for reference, the ligatures from Fira Code are: The “missing” ligatures can be obtained by removing the characters verbatim wants to treat in a special way because traditional TeX fonts have ligatures; by default, fontspec doesn't apply Ligatures=TeX to the monospaced font, so there's no risk in redefining \[email protected]@list to empty. Pro. 👉 Note: If you are using Visual Studio Code, you will have to enable font ligatures in your settings in order to see them. You can try Fira Code, it’s just awesome and open source. Short answer: yes, the Ligatures support works out of the box – no settings other then choosing the font is needed. Enabling font ligatures. If you've ever used Microsoft Word, it's substitution rules are very close to what ligatures are; with a difference, that Word really replaces the text with a substitution so original text is gone. Make an informed decision Mono has a collection of fonts that support ligatures Image. To learn more about setting up Powerline in Windows Terminal page iScript and Fira Code as my new font... For reading Code without your eyes getting tired with VSCode from the Code! To setup all my IDE and editors with Fira Code, but now switched. Try a few additional glyphs to display multiple consecutive characters as one custom!... Our Code in Visual Studio are enabled by default some people and most importantly all... Multiple results - such as this article by Mohammed Zama Khan a messy codebase slightly... My choice for the past two years been using Fira Code Mono patched with ligatures in Visual Code. Dank Mono patched with nerd fonts has a very clean and beautiful design my new dev font by! This example from FiraCode’s GitHub repo: some people love ligatures for Mozilla to fit in with character! Single logical one ligatures only where you want them, not where you want them, not where want. Very clean and beautiful design and most importantly, all these fonts are free text and allow you display. Fonts along with ligatures built with programming, that basically means you’ll see ⇒ instead of = > and instead... Below, I 've been using Fira Code over the competition to solve the problem of character.. Example below fantasque Sans Mono is crystal clear which makes it a good choice for reading Code without eyes! Used in the example below Mono patched with nerd fonts + Operator Mono which 's $ 200 and free! Certain cases what works for you with coding ligatures ( according to www.slant.co ) coding with.. Ligatures supported '' is the primary reason people pick Fira Code, it’s just awesome open... By combining characters ligatures supported '' is the primary reason people pick Fira Code + Operator set! Using ligatures and cursive fonts will yield multiple results - such as this article by Mohammed Khan! Used to setup all my IDE and editors with Fira Code over the competition which 's 200! Used in the example below you can make your editor can give digital. To balance whitespace more efficiently by shifting the glyphs in certain cases up in... It is a free option is Fira Code Visual Studio may support a different number of Once. Snap of my Code, but now I switched everything to Cascadia Code the same Code snippet our Code VSCode! Fit in with the looks of this font you haven’t used Operator Mono fonts and so.! Primarily in frontend development, so try a few to decide what works for you which... Any font Visual Studio are enabled by default for reading Code without your eyes getting tired most when. My primary editor people love ligatures Fira Code over the competition is powered by a knowledgeable that... Some people productivity boost that basically means you’ll see ⇒ instead of = and... Frontend development, so VSCode is my choice for the past two.... You a glow of satisfaction when you open some Code you are proud.! The screenshot is the primary reason people pick Fira Code is an extension of Fira Mono, a font. Through the process of configuring ligatures in Visual Studio my primary editor plugin! Programming fonts with ligatures they also provide a script which can patch any font used Operator Mono set with CSS! Main editor, having a clean UI can bring a productivity boost certain.... Time to personalise the look and feel of your editor look better with awesome fonts along with ligatures with! With the looks of this font best free fonts you recommend to use while writing Code, it’s just and... Logical one pick Fira Code, find the differences is used in the below! To describe when two or more characters ( or graphemes ) are joined as a single logical.! Are probably your best bets out of the 11 options considered = and so on it make... You are proud of are joined as a single glyph customizing typography VS. Page is powered by a knowledgeable community that helps you make an informed decision a common command-line that!

Advanced English Speaking Course Online, Warhammer Champions Booster Box, How Much Is The Courier Newspaper, Best Camcorder Under $100, How To Calibrate A Food Scale, Denim 'n Lace, Supply And Demand Practice Worksheet Answer Key,

Add Comment

Your email address will not be published. Required fields are marked *

I accept the Privacy Policy

X